What does a remote coding manager do?

A remote coding manager is a health care professional who oversees medical coders or a coding department online. Your responsibilities in this career are to provide procedural guidance to other medical coders and electronic health records specialist and review medical information to ensure its accuracy. As a manager, your other duties include scheduling meetings with members of your department, responding to emails, and communicating with other health care professionals and managers. Because you work from home, you need to have reliable and secure internet access due to the private nature of the information, such as diagnostic reviews of a patient.

What does a remote coding manager do?

A Remote Coding Manager oversees a team of medical coders who work from various locations, ensuring that healthcare services are accurately coded for billing and compliance purposes. They are responsible for hiring, training, and managing coders, as well as monitoring productivity and quality. Remote Coding Managers also stay updated on coding guidelines and industry regulations to minimize errors and ensure compliance. Effective communication and organizational skills are essential in this role, as they coordinate workflows and resolve any issues that arise among remote staff.

How does a remote coding manager effectively lead and support a distributed team of medical coders?

A Remote Coding Manager typically oversees a team of medical coders working from various locations, using digital tools and regular virtual meetings to maintain clear communication and workflow efficiency. They coordinate coding assignments, perform quality checks, and provide ongoing training to ensure accuracy and compliance with healthcare regulations. Building team cohesion remotely can be a challenge, so strong leadership skills, proactive check-ins, and fostering an inclusive team culture are crucial. Additionally, Remote Coding Managers often collaborate with other departments, such as billing and compliance, to resolve discrepancies and improve processes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ote coding man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Coding Manager, you need in-depth knowledge of medical coding (ICD-10, CPT, HCPCS), leadership experience, and often a credential such as CCS or CPC. Familiarity with health information management systems, EHRs, and remote collaboration tools is essential. Strong communication, attention to detail, and the ability to motivate and manage distributed teams are standout soft skills. These competencies ensure accurate coding compliance, efficient team performance, and effective management in a remote healthcare environment.

Job description

FT, 80 hrs/pp, 1.0 FTE; varies as scheduled Remote. (For Washington State Residents Only)


Summary:

The Remote Medical Coder will utilize their expertise, analytical and problem-solving skills to identify and resolve coding issues to assure timely and compliant processing of clinic charges and optimized efficient workflow. Responsible for analyzing and assessing the quality of clinical documentation in order to accurately identify and capture all codeable and billable diagnosis that will involve assignments of ICD-10-CM, CPT, Modifiers and HCPCS for Family General Practice,Specialty,OB/GYN clinic settings, and Hospital.  Will also assist with Provider documentation and feedback.

This position performs coding duties remotely while maintaining productivity, quality, and compliance standards. Ability to work independently in a remote environment. 

Education and/or Experience Requirements:      

  • High school diploma or equivalent. Associate degree in related field and/or Certificate in Medical Coding & Reimbursement Specialist leading to the credentialing by the American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C) or American Health Information management Association (AHIMA) preferred.
  • Minimum of two (2) years of related experience and/or training of medical billing, charge entry, revenue cycle, or coding-related experience in physician clinic, hospital or healthcare setting. Experience in Epic EHR systems and 3M encoder. 

Licensure & Certifications Requirements: 

  • Perferred CPC-A, CPC, COC, CCS-P cerfitications.
  • Non-certified candidates must meet experience requirements and enroll in an approved coding certification program within six (6) months of hire.
  • Obtain preferred certification within 12-18 months of hire.
